I play out every major league game in my league from the 7th inning on. It's very easy to do, just a matter of going into Commissioner Mode and then clicking on the View/Play Game button that shows up. You do have to specify what you want to control and what you don't (I generally let the computer control defensive and pitching choices whereas I control offensive choices and substitutions) before each and every game but that also gives you the opportunity to take a glance at every team. If you want to play out the minors as well (too much for me but go ahead) you just click on the drop down menu in the top right hand corner of the screen to switch between leagues.

As Eugene has stated, you will learn the players in your league far, far quicker if you do things this way. I suggest playing out until the 7th because most of the really big decisions are either made prior to the game or after the 6th anyway and this allows you to get through things about 3 times as fast as playing out every inning. This does mean you get less hands-on experience with the part of the game that has had by far the most work put into it (the development engine) and instead use an aspect that perhaps hasn't seen as much (the in-game engine) but it's still well worth playing, especially if you don't like seeing seasons go by at a breakneck pace.
